West Papua's Exports Increased by 37.29 Percent in July 2024

The Central Statistics Agency (BPS) of West Papua recorded an export realization of USD 436.45 million for July 2024, reflecting a 37.29% month-to-month (mtm) increase. Coal Exports to India Still a Mainstay for Aceh Province, Reaching IDR 573 Billion in July 2024

Coal remains a leading export commodity for Aceh, with India being the primary destination for exports from Nagan Raya and West Aceh.
